Omaha Resident Sentenced for Prostituting Minor
United States Attorney Joe W. Stecher and the Federal Bureau of Investigation announce
the following information for the attention of the media:
Event Triggering this Release: The Honorable Joseph F. Bataillon, Chief United States
District Judge, sentenced Amar Henderson to 144 months' imprisonment following his
conviction for two counts of transporting a minor in interstate commerce with intent to
engage in prostitution. In addition to the term of imprisonment, Henderson was ordered
to serve five years of supervised release and pay a $200 special assessment.
Henderson came to the attention of law enforcement when a 17-year-old prostitute
was arrested in Council Bluffs. She reported to law enforcement that her pimp was Amar
Henderson. Henderson told her, when she was 16, that she could earn easy money by
prostituting. She told police that she would advertise herself, at the request of Henderson,
on the Internet as an “escort”. She would then meet clients in Omaha and Council Bluffs
and perform sex acts for money. The money that she earned would be turned over to
Henderson. She also was physically abused by Henderson. On several occasions she and
Henderson would travel to Florida on Southwest airlines for the purpose of engaging in
prostitution. She engaged in sexual intercourse with Henderson both in Omaha and in
Florida. The prostitute stated that on one occasion in November, 2006 she performed her
first act of prostitution with Devon Smith in Iowa. She stated that she and Smith were
driven from Omaha to Iowa by Henderson’s step father, Charles Jones.
During the investigation, another underage prostitute who worked for Henderson
was discovered. She had begun working for Henderson when she was 13 years old. She
was also transported across state lines for the purposes of prostitution and had a sexual
relationship with Henderson.
Once Henderson was indicted and detained, he placed several phone calls to
Devon Smith where he instructed her to destroy all evidence of prostitution in the home.
Ms. Smith complied with his request.
